Job title: DHHS- IT Lead EDI Specialist

Responsibilities

  • High degree of business and technical knowledge with significant practical experience in HIPAA X12 EDI Transactions.
  • Expert in EDI mapping for 837, 277CA, 834, 835, TA1, 999, 820, NCPDP D.0
  • Develop and execute test scripts related to X12 Transmission
  • Conducts QA and Testing on EDI applications
  • Experience setting up users/new Trading Partner relationships, standards, envelope and full cycle testing
  • Provides technical support during and after implementation for healthcare electronic data interchange applications
  • Responds to inquiries regarding EDI issues with encounter claims and trading partner activities
  • Management of catalog of EDI document types such as 837, 277CA, 834, 835, TA1, 999, 820, NCPDP D.0
  • Communication between Trading Partners and department
